Carpet fibers can be either bulked continuous filament bcf or staple staple fibers shed more than bcf fibers.
This doesn t affect the long term quality of the carpet but it does mean you ll have to vacuum more often until the initial shedding stops which can take up to a year and it can also be an issue for allergy sufferers.

There are five major types of carpet fiber nylon 6 6 nylon 6 polypropylene olefin polyester and wool.
Ideal for carpeting nylon 6 6 is a man made fiber that is wear resistant soil and stain resistant.
Nylon is a resilient fiber resistant to crush and wear therefore a great fit for high traffic areas such as stairs and hallways.
